A Post-Market Domestic (US) and International Data Collection to Assess the Truliant® Knee System
- Detailed Description
Patient outcomes data is important for assessing the post-market safety and effectiveness of orthopedic medical devices. The purpose of this study is to collect clinical and patient outcomes and survivorship data for patients who have received or will receive a Truliant® knee prosthesis manufactured or distributed by Exactech Inc (Gainesville, Florida, USA).

Cohort 1. Prospective / Subjects- Enrolled in the study pre-surgery
- Subjects who agree to participate in the study that have not had surgery prior to being enrolled in the study.
- Skeletally mature (18 years of age or older).
- Subject is willing and able to provide written informed consent for participation in the study.
- Subject is to receive a Truliant® total knee replacement for Osteoarthritis, Avascular Necrosis, Rheumatoid Arthritis, Post-Traumatic Arthritis, Polyarthritis, Primary Implantation Failure, or as a Conversion of Uni-Compartmental Knee.
- The knee replacement will be performed by the investigator or a surgeon sub-investigator.
- The devices will be used according to the approved indications.
